IT appears that Simon Jones has an influential fan on the selection panel at England HQ.
New skipper Kevin Pietersen revealed last week that he wanted to take Worcestershire’s pace ace on tour to India in November.
However, knee surgery has prevented the 29-year-old Welshman from completing this campaign and jumping on that plane to the sub-continent.
Jones is going to be on crutches for another seven weeks before he can even start his rehabilitation, but this is an injury that’s thankfully not as serious as his previous knee woes.

The Llanelli lad still has a remote possibility of making the trip to the West Indies in January, but a lack of competitive cricket makes the chances slim.
“I am a huge Simon Jones fan,” the new England skipper said.
“I have always kept in contact with him and speak with him regularly.
“I am perhaps not as distraught as he is with the operation he had — I wanted Simon to come to India and play for me for England.
“He was an unsung hero in the Ashes of 2005 where he had brilliant statistics.
“He definitely has it and is somebody who really wants to get involved with England again.”
Jones will undoubtedly start next season wearing the three pears of Worcestershire but will he end the campaign wearing the three lions of England?
